Bug description:
I was installing a new laptop with manual installation and MBR
encrypted partitions following http://linuxbsdos.com/2014/05/28/how-
to-install-ubuntu-14-04-on-encrypted-mbr-partitions/
After setting up the partitions (one /boot, one encrypted /, one
encrypted swap, and one encrypted /home) I got the "summary screen"
with the actions that are gonna be taken and then got an error saying
that the / can't be mounted. I tried three times and it failed. Then I
noticed on the "summary screen" that all the encrypted partitions (and
/boot) were marked as "to be formatted" beside the /. When I went and
manually changed it to swap and then to / again ticking the "format"
box it worked.
